Freelancing and Online Gig Economy

Freelancing has become a popular way for individuals to monetize their skills, and platforms like Upwork, Fiverr, and Freelancer have made it easier than ever to connect with potential clients. By offering services such as content writing, graphic design, web development, and social media management, individuals can earn a steady income from the comfort of their own homes.

Another popular option in the online gig economy is online tutoring. With the rise of e-learning, there is a growing demand for online tutors who can provide one-on-one instruction to students in need of academic support. Platforms like TutorMe, Chegg, and Varsity Tutors have made it easy for individuals to monetize their teaching skills and connect with students from all over the world.

Blogging and Affiliate Marketing

Blogging and affiliate marketing are two related concepts that have become increasingly popular in recent years. By creating a blog around a specific niche or topic, individuals can attract a large following and monetize their content through advertising, sponsored posts, and affiliate marketing.

With affiliate marketing, individuals can earn commissions by promoting products or services from other companies and earning a percentage of the sale price. This can be a lucrative way to monetize a blog, especially if you have a large following and can promote high-ticket items.

Dropshipping and Online Storefronts

Dropshipping and online storefronts are two related concepts that have become increasingly popular in recent years. By partnering with a supplier to sell their products without holding any inventory, individuals can earn a commission on each sale without having to worry about storage or shipping.

Online storefronts like Shopify and WooCommerce have made it easy for individuals to create and manage an online store, and can be monetized through sales, advertising, and affiliate marketing. Q: How do I get paid for working online in Kenya?

Most online platforms in Kenya offer secure payment methods, such as PayPal, M-Pesa, and bank transfers. You can also use local payment gateways like Lipa Later or PesaPal. It’s essential to understand the payment terms and conditions of each platform before signing up.

Q: What are the tax implications of making money online in Kenya?

As a Kenyan making money online, you are subject to Kenyan tax laws. You may need to file taxes on your online income, and you may be required to pay Value Added Tax (VAT) on certain online transactions. It’s recommended to consult a tax professional or accountant to understand your tax obligations.
